Your usercode wasn't being found. What happens if you run sasldblistusers2 as a user who can read the DB file? It should list lines of "[EMAIL PROTECTED]: userPassword"; the realm will be the one you need to see in Exim; it defaults to the host fqdn so if you created the user accounts on the host with saslpasswd2 then that's the realm you need to see.
